Transaction 69fe1155a9f73f5a7988005ff998dff131c4774c3adf7b19088268c72d6be3b5
1 Input
1 Output
-
69fe1155a9f73f5a7988005ff998dff131c4774c3adf7b19088268c72d6be3b5:0
- value
- 635556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7b99cd4b6b0bb94227000a33313c91bfbc800e7 OP_EQUAL
- address
- 3MMfZNtmuneQgdLbYcykcTvWsteYxFN3Ja